Care Certificate 2025: What UK Care Workers Need to Know
The Care Certificate is essential for UK care workers. Updated in March 2025, it now includes 16 standards, including a brand-new one: Awareness of Learning Disabilities & Autism.
Whether you’re a new starter or refreshing your skills, these updates help you stay confident, compliant, and career-ready.
What’s New in 2025?
Standard 16: Focus on learning disabilities & autism
Digital Skills: Use tech safely for care plans & communication
Reflective Practice & Inclusive Language: Deliver person-centred care
Updated Learning Outcomes: Career growth + key support networks

How to Complete the 2025 Care Certificate
Courses cover all 16 standards, including:
Duty of care & confidentiality
Health, safety & infection prevention
Equality, diversity & inclusion
Communication & person-centred care
Safeguarding concerns
Learning disabilities & autism support
